Coup militias shell houses in Dhi Na'em, al-Beidha

BEIDHA-SABA
The Saleh-Houthi coup militias are persisting with their day –to-day abductions of people and shelling of residences in al-Beidha province. "The coup militias stationed in Tabbat Sharqan site indiscriminately shelled the houses and properties in Dhi Na'em with heavy weapons," local sources told Saba.
"The militias kidnapped one man and his son after assaulting them brutally in Assomaah, and kidnapped another and his son as they were driving by one of the militia's checkpoints."
Meanwhile, Ashaab Nser, another area in al-Beidha, saw heavy clashes between the militia and the resistance fighters.
In Assomaah, three militiamen were also killed in an attack by resistance fighters on their outpost.
